The study, detailed in the October issue of the American Meteorological Society's journal Weather and Forecasting, found that from 1950 to 2005, 27 percent of tornadoes in the United States were nocturnal, yet 39 percent of tornado fatalities and 42 percent of killer tornado events occurred at night. read more
